Web30 nov. 2015 · The government figures show that 52% of those assessed in prison have the equivalent capability in Maths which compares with 49% of the general public. The statistics also show that 46% of newly assessed prisoners have Level 1 and Level 2 literacy skills, (GCSE equivalent) which compares to 85% of the general population.
